FAQs: Travel from Glasgow to Penrith

Travel to Penrith eas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Glasgow to Penrith.

FAQs
There are 2 options to travel between Glasgow and Penrith including taking a train and bus.
The cheapest way to travel from Glasgow to Penrith is a bus with an average price of $8 (€6).

This is compared to other travel options from Glasgow to Penrith:

A bus is $14 (€11) less than a train for this route with tickets for a train from Glasgow to Penrith costing on average $22 (€18).

The fastest way to travel from Glasgow to Penrith is by train with an average journey time of 1h 24m.

Other travel options to Penrith take longer:

Bus takes on average 2h 35m.

The distance from Glasgow to Penrith is approximately 101 miles (164 km).
The average frequency per day from Glasgow to Penrith is:
  • Around 6 trains per day.
  • Around 2 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Glasgow and Penrith as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Glasgow to Penrith:
  • Trains mostly depart from Glasgow Central (GLC) and arrive in Penrith station (PNR).
  • Buses mostly depart from Glasgow, Buchanan Bus Station and arrive in Penrith, Brunswick Road (Booths).
